<div>Welcome to Offer Accepted, a podcast focused on hiring strategies for a new era. In each episode, we break down one viral hiring post from an industry expert.&nbsp;<br><br>Here's the problem: everyone within an organization turns to HR for advice on all things related to people, attraction, hiring, and retention. However, people in HR often lack someone to turn to for advice. This is where we come in. Our podcast provides a space for Founders, Leaders, HR professionals, Recruiters, and anyone involved in hiring within a company.<br><br>Throughout our discussions, we will cover topics such as attraction, hiring, retention, onboarding, culture, employment law, layoffs, and much more – all things related to the world of work. We encourage you to get involved, send in your questions, and help ensure that HR professionals and hiring managers have a reliable source of advice.<br>Join us on this journey to navigate the ever-changing landscape of hiring in today's world. Welcome to Offer Accepted, where we make the world of work work better.</div>

Ali Kaizer - Managing Recruiting as a Sales Function

<p>Alison is the Head of Talent at Golden Ventures. She supports the portfolio in building effective and scalable talent programs in today’s competitive market.</p><p>Most recently, Ali led Talent at food-tech startup Lunchbox, where she grew the team from 50 to 250 North American team members. Before this, she was the first Talent Acquisition hire at Ritual.co, and led the charge as Head of Talent while they built the systems to scale and expanded across North America, Europe, Hong Kong and Australia. Her previous experience is varied and includes recruitment in a boutique agency, management consulting, and marketing.<br/><br/></p><p>Ali studied Management, International Business and Marketing at New York University’s Stern School of Business. Andrea Bartlett - Career Cushioning

<p>Building a career that is focused on people, Andrea believes that businesses should understand their employee journey as well as they know the client journey and product roadmap. Andrea brings Human Resources experience in both public and private organizations, in industries including wholesale distribution, financial services, hospitality, biopharmaceutical R&amp;D, and technology. Working alongside Founding and Executive team members, Andrea has extensive experience in People &amp; Talent, specializing in the areas of talent management &amp; recruiting strategy, people operations, total rewards, organizational design &amp; scaling, retention &amp; talent development, and leadership training &amp; coaching. She is currently the Vice President, People &amp; Organization Development at Lillio (formerly <a href='https://www.lillio.com/resources/himama-is-now-lillio'>HiMama</a>), where she leads a team of People &amp; Talent professionals, excited about bringing high-quality tools to the early childhood space.  </p><p>In her spare time, she provides fractional HR support to small businesses, is an Expert in Residence (EiR) with the DMZ (Digital Media Zone) Innisfill office, and the Rogers Cybersecurity Catalyst program.
